WAYNE, Illinois, Aug. 22, 2018–Heather Blitz and Quatero began their campaign for the Intermediate 1 United States championship by winning the Prix St. Georges Wednesday at a bigger than ever Festival of Champions. The imminent World Equestrian Games, however, has depleted the headline Grand Prix lineup.

Heather, based in Loxahatchee, Florida, and the nine-year-old Danish Warmblood gelding came into these championships as the top ranked small tour combination. with 10 victories in 12 starts in CDIs in the past 16 months.

The pair were awarded 72.853 per cent for the win with scores from the Intermediate 1 and the Freestyle to come to count to decide the title.

Jennifer Baumert returning for the second year with Handsome in the Intermediate 1 Championship placed second on 71.735 per cent. The CDI record for Jennifer, of Wellington, Florida and the 13-year-old Hanoverian gelding, ranked second in U.S. qualifying, was eight wins in 11 starts on the Florida winter circuit.

Nora Batchelder of Ocala, Florida and Faro SQF were third on 69.971 per cent.

Codi Harrison of Augusta, Kansas on Katholt’s Bossco won the Brentina Cup Intermediate II on a score of 71.941 per cent in the first year in the Under-25 division for the pair. Codi and the 11-year-old Danish Warmblood stallion competed in the 2016 and 2017 North American Young Rider Championships.

Molly Paris of Charlotte, North Carolina and Countess were second on 69.147 per cent with Kerrigan Gluch of Wellington, Florida on HGF Brio third on 68.147 per cent.

The championships for the first time combine seven competition divisions ranging from children to Grand Prix and five young and developing horse events from four-year-olds to developing Grand Prix.

The national championships come less than three weeks before the World Equestrian Games in Tryon, North Carolina with America’s top five combinations on the team and a reserve and following a lengthy qualifying schedule in California and Florida then Europe. The 13 highest ranked U.S. combinations on the world standings are not competing in the Grand Prix.

This event also falls during the opening of the school year in many states and after the North American Youth Championships at the beginning of August.
